    Collectively referred to as woody fungi, they are fungi that use cellulose and lignin from wood as carbon nutrients. Such as shiitake mushroom, tiger skin shiitake mushroom, pink side ear, yellow and white side ear, pink fold side ear, blood ear, oyster mushroom, elm yellow mushroom, tea mushroom and so on are suitable for growing in broad-leaved tree wood. For example, leopard skin shiitake mushrooms, shell-shaped side ears, etc., are suitable for growing on coniferous trees.

    Such as capsule, spoon-shaped ear, leather ear, purple leather ear, white fungus, black fungus, hairy fungus, white fungus, sand fungus, enoki mushroom, heap of money mushroom, dense ring fungus, pig ling, steak mushroom, ink ghost umbrella, hairy ghost umbrella, slippery mushroom, lion's mane mushroom, oyster mushroom, silver silk grass mushroom, Ganoderma lucidum, etc. are suitable for growing on the wood. Whereas, the ferul ear is only suitable for growing on the ferul plant.
